In «The Middle Aged Man on the Flying Trapeze,» James Thurber employs his signature blend of humor and poignancy to explore the existential dilemmas of modern life. This collection of short stories is characterized by its witty observations and absurdist scenarios, encapsulating the frustrations and vulnerabilities of middle age. Written during the early 20th century, a time of significant cultural shifts, Thurber's narratives reflect the anxieties of an era grappling with rapid change, embodying a delightful interplay between the mundane and the fantastical through a distinctly American lens. James Thurber was a noted humorist, cartoonist, and playwright, whose own experiences with the trials of life undoubtedly influenced his writing. Having been both an observer and a participant in the complexities of middle age, Thurber draws upon his unique perspective and keen insight into human nature. His contributions to The New Yorker and his passion for storytelling highlight his ability to capture the intricacies of ordinary existence, making his work both relatable and deeply resonant with readers.
